It screws into the left end of the speedometer housing, which can either be reached from underneath the dashboard (if you have small, thin hands), or unscrew and pull off the top part of the dashboard and reach in from the top. The other end, of course, screws into the side of the transmission.

Make sure you only lube the bottom third of the cable.  It will work it's own way up. If you lube the whole cable it will likely work into the speedo head and cause all kinds of troubles.

I *think* that you can pull the inner cable out from the end where it connects to the transmission.  I just did this on my 60, and it should be similar to yours.  I'm working on a 55 Pontiac, and it is the same way.

Many cables will have a collar at the speedometer end, especially if a repair kit was used in the past and cannot be pulled from the transmission end.
